Salvar grafico como Imagen

30/08/2005 - 10:49 por Iñaki | Informe spam
Hola!!

Tengo una imagen que utilizo para firmar encima de ella.
Lo que quiero es guardar el grafico como imagen para luego poder
imprimirla.
Como podrias guardarla?

Este es el codigo de creacion :

BackGroundImage = new Bitmap(Path.Combine(AppPath,ImageFileName));

GraphicsHandle = Graphics.FromImage(BackGroundImage);




Muchas Gracias

IÑaki

Preguntas similare

Leer las respuestas

#1 Iñaki
31/08/2005 - 08:19 | Informe spam
Gracias.
La cuestion es que es para pocket pc y no tanot image como bitmap no tiene
el metodo save.

"Bela Istok" escribió en el mensaje
news:
En las pruebas que hice, todo lo que tu hagas en Graphics se ve reflejado
en la imagen, asi que no hace falta hacer ninguna conversion desde
Graphics hacia imagen, aqui tengo un codigo de ejemplo:

Image i = Image.FromFile("Bitmap1.jpg");

this.pictureBox1.Image = i;

Graphics g = Graphics.FromImage(i);

g.DrawLine(new Pen(new SolidBrush(Color.Red),1),new Point(0,0),new
Point(50,50));

g.Dispose();

i.Save("Bitmap2.jpg");

Y envio adjuntas las 2 imagenes.

Saludos,

Bela Istok

"Iñaki" wrote in message
news:OAVht%
Hola!!

Tengo una imagen que utilizo para firmar encima de ella.
Lo que quiero es guardar el grafico como imagen para luego poder
imprimirla.
Como podrias guardarla?

Este es el codigo de creacion :

BackGroundImage = new Bitmap(Path.Combine(AppPath,ImageFileName));

GraphicsHandle = Graphics.FromImage(BackGroundImage);




Muchas Gracias

IÑaki







Respuesta Responder a este mensaje
#2 Bela Istok
31/08/2005 - 12:42 | Informe spam
Bitmap es una clase que deriva de Image :P

"Iñaki" wrote in message
news:%
Gracias.
La cuestion es que es para pocket pc y no tanot image como bitmap no tiene
el metodo save.

"Bela Istok" escribió en el mensaje
news:
En las pruebas que hice, todo lo que tu hagas en Graphics se ve reflejado
en la imagen, asi que no hace falta hacer ninguna conversion desde
Graphics hacia imagen, aqui tengo un codigo de ejemplo:

Image i = Image.FromFile("Bitmap1.jpg");

this.pictureBox1.Image = i;

Graphics g = Graphics.FromImage(i);

g.DrawLine(new Pen(new SolidBrush(Color.Red),1),new Point(0,0),new
Point(50,50));

g.Dispose();

i.Save("Bitmap2.jpg");

Y envio adjuntas las 2 imagenes.

Saludos,

Bela Istok

"Iñaki" wrote in message
news:OAVht%
Hola!!

Tengo una imagen que utilizo para firmar encima de ella.
Lo que quiero es guardar el grafico como imagen para luego poder
imprimirla.
Como podrias guardarla?

Este es el codigo de creacion :

BackGroundImage = new Bitmap(Path.Combine(AppPath,ImageFileName));

GraphicsHandle = Graphics.FromImage(BackGroundImage);




Muchas Gracias

IÑaki











Respuesta Responder a este mensaje
#3 Bela Istok
31/08/2005 - 15:55 | Informe spam
Y si por lo visto en el Compact, no existe el metodo Save (Una gran omision
:s).

Saludos,

Bela Istok
"Iñaki" wrote in message
news:%
Gracias.
La cuestion es que es para pocket pc y no tanot image como bitmap no tiene
el metodo save.

"Bela Istok" escribió en el mensaje
news:
En las pruebas que hice, todo lo que tu hagas en Graphics se ve reflejado
en la imagen, asi que no hace falta hacer ninguna conversion desde
Graphics hacia imagen, aqui tengo un codigo de ejemplo:

Image i = Image.FromFile("Bitmap1.jpg");

this.pictureBox1.Image = i;

Graphics g = Graphics.FromImage(i);

g.DrawLine(new Pen(new SolidBrush(Color.Red),1),new Point(0,0),new
Point(50,50));

g.Dispose();

i.Save("Bitmap2.jpg");

Y envio adjuntas las 2 imagenes.

Saludos,

Bela Istok

"Iñaki" wrote in message
news:OAVht%
Hola!!

Tengo una imagen que utilizo para firmar encima de ella.
Lo que quiero es guardar el grafico como imagen para luego poder
imprimirla.
Como podrias guardarla?

Este es el codigo de creacion :

BackGroundImage = new Bitmap(Path.Combine(AppPath,ImageFileName));

GraphicsHandle = Graphics.FromImage(BackGroundImage);




Muchas Gracias

IÑaki











Respuesta Responder a este mensaje
#4 Bela Istok
31/08/2005 - 16:04 | Informe spam
Como nota curiosa el CF 2.0 si tiene un Metodo Save en Image ;)

Saludos,

Bela Istok

"Iñaki" wrote in message
news:%
Gracias.
La cuestion es que es para pocket pc y no tanot image como bitmap no tiene
el metodo save.

"Bela Istok" escribió en el mensaje
news:
En las pruebas que hice, todo lo que tu hagas en Graphics se ve reflejado
en la imagen, asi que no hace falta hacer ninguna conversion desde
Graphics hacia imagen, aqui tengo un codigo de ejemplo:

Image i = Image.FromFile("Bitmap1.jpg");

this.pictureBox1.Image = i;

Graphics g = Graphics.FromImage(i);

g.DrawLine(new Pen(new SolidBrush(Color.Red),1),new Point(0,0),new
Point(50,50));

g.Dispose();

i.Save("Bitmap2.jpg");

Y envio adjuntas las 2 imagenes.

Saludos,

Bela Istok

"Iñaki" wrote in message
news:OAVht%
Hola!!

Tengo una imagen que utilizo para firmar encima de ella.
Lo que quiero es guardar el grafico como imagen para luego poder
imprimirla.
Como podrias guardarla?

Este es el codigo de creacion :

BackGroundImage = new Bitmap(Path.Combine(AppPath,ImageFileName));

GraphicsHandle = Graphics.FromImage(BackGroundImage);




Muchas Gracias

IÑaki











email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ida